Fresno Fair Box Office: Hours, Payment Options, and Seating Information

Overview of the Fresno Fair Box Office

The Fresno Fair box office is the primary on-site point for purchasing tickets, requesting refunds or exchanges, and getting event-specific information during the Fresno Fair season. This guide explains how the box office works, where it is located, when it is open, what payment methods are accepted, and what to expect when you arrive. The information below is designed to help you plan ahead, reduce wait times, and navigate seating and entry details with confidence.

Box Office Location and Facility Access

The Fresno Fair box office is situated within the fairgrounds near the main entrance and central concourse, making it easy to find whether you are driving, taking public transit, or walking from nearby parking. Staffed windows and a service desk are typically positioned for both walk-in visitors and attendees with printed or mobile tickets. Clear signage and wayfinding elements point visitors from parking areas and gates to the ticket office, and staff are available to assist with directions if needed.

Operating Hours and Peak Times

The Fresno Fair box office generally operates during fair days, with extended hours on the busiest event days. Hours are typically reduced on the first and final days of the fair or when fewer events are scheduled. Arriving early in the day or just after major event changes can reduce lines, while evenings and closing days tend to have higher traffic. Checking the official Fresno Fair schedule in advance helps you choose the best time to visit the box office.

Suggested Timing to Minimize Wait

  • Early morning when gates open and fair activity is low.
  • Midday lulls between major performances or events.
  • Avoid right after headline acts or at the fair closing window.

Payment Options and Ticketing Policies

At the Fresno Fair box office, payment methods commonly include cash, major credit cards, and sometimes mobile wallet options if connectivity allows. Ticket policies for refunds, exchanges, and transfers vary by event type and vendor rules, so it is best to review conditions before purchasing. Some events may require tickets to be picked up in person or scanned from a mobile device, while others are print-at-home or downloadable. Keeping your confirmation email or order number accessible can make transactions at the box office smoother.

Event Seating and Entry Overview

Event seating at the Fresno Fair ranges from general admission areas near stages to reserved seats in grandstands and auditoriums, depending on the show or competition. Entry gates usually open at posted times, and attendees are admitted after ticket verification and, when required, bag checks. Knowing your seat location or event zone in advance helps you choose the right entrance and move safely through the grounds. If you are unsure of your seating or entry point, checking your ticket details or asking box office staff can provide clarity.

Seating and Entry Checklist

  • Review ticket for section, row, and gate information.
  • Arrive with sufficient time before event start.
  • Bring valid ID if age verification or restricted seating applies.
  • Follow staff directions at gates and seating areas.

Common Questions and Clarifications

Visitors often ask whether tickets purchased online must be picked up at the Fresno Fair box office, how to find their seats, and what to bring on fair day. In many cases, mobile tickets are accepted at the gate, while some events encourage or require on-site pickup depending on vendor or security rules. Box office staff can confirm ticket eligibility, explain seating layouts, and help resolve entry issues. Planning ahead with event details and arrival logistics makes the experience smoother for attendees of all kinds.
